Though modest in size, Woolwich station is equipped with essential amenities to meet the needs of its travelers. While there isn't a traditional ticket office, numerous ticket machines are available for those ready to purchase or collect tickets bought online. Accessibility is prioritized here, with step-free access available throughout the station and staff assistance on hand when needed. Travelers will also appreciate the well-located customer help points, information screens, and public announcements providing timely updates for an easy journey.
For individuals requiring personal assistance, Woolwich offers an inclusive service with the option of booking through Passenger Assist. Whether you're planning to head out on a national rail service or another part of London's network, arranging help has never been easier.
Woolwich station isn't just a launching point for rail journeys; it’s seamlessly connected to multiple transport links. The station is served by Transport for London buses, facilitating local travel for those continuing their journey by road. The Docklands Light Railway (DLR) provides swift connections to various other parts of London, enhancing the station's accessibility. Moreover, Woolwich delivers rail services directly to London’s Heathrow Airport Terminals 2 and 3, 4, and 5, a boon for jet-setters and Heathrow-bound passengers alike.

Belper station may not boast extravagant facilities, but it caters to the essential needs of its passengers. Although there is no manned ticket office, ticket machines are available and easily accessible for collecting pre-purchased tickets. Plus, accessible ticket machines ensure that everyone can manage their travel independently with ease. While waiting for your train, you'll find no waiting rooms or lounges, so it might be best to plan your arrival just before your scheduled departure time. It's worth noting there's no refreshment or shopping facilities on-site, so perhaps grab a coffee before you arrive!
The station has made efforts to accommodate passengers with mobility challenges, marked as a category B station. Step-free access is available, but be prepared for steep ramps which might pose a challenge for some. A customer help point is available, but if you're planning a journey and require assistance, it's a good idea to book in advance using the Passenger Assist service. However, there's no wheelchair availability or parking facilities designated for those with impaired mobility.
Connectivity to and from Belper station is straightforward, with convenient transport links available. If you need to transfer to a rail replacement service, head to the A6, opposite The Lion Hotel. For those planning to continue their journey by bus, information is readily available, and can be viewed conveniently online here. Although the station lacks dedicated taxi or car hire services, local options can often be arranged ahead of time if required.
